Percept Weddings, the exclusive luxury weddings and social events division of Percept Limited, brought to life an exquisitely curated destination wedding for Raina Singh and Ankush Sehgal along the serene shores of Doha, Qatar. Thoughtfully conceptualized, produced and executed end-to-end, the grand celebration held from 23rd – 26th January 2026, reflected a refined interplay of cultural depth, bespoke design and contemporary global luxury.

Raina Singh and Ankush Sehgal Wedding in Doha, Qatar

Percept Weddings helmed every facet of the wedding festivities, from creative conception and design, to end-to-end production, hospitality, entertainment curation, guest management, and flawless on-ground execution. Set against the dramatic expanse of Hilton Salwa Beach Resort & Villas, the celebration unfolded at a rare geographic crossroads, where the shores of Qatar intersect with Bahrain and Saudi Arabia across the endless horizon. Standing at this edge felt surreal, imbuing the wedding with a timeless magnificence. The resort’s sweeping seascape became an intrinsic part of the wedding narrative, transforming the beachfront into a living canvas of refined luxury, timeless romance, and aesthetic grandeur.

Raina Singh, daughter of Mr. Parambir Singh and Mrs. Savita Singh, and Ankush Sehgal, son of Mr. Mukesh Sehgal and Mrs. Vandna Sehgal, brought together 550 close family members and friends from across the world, making the wedding a truly global destination affair. Envisioned by the families as an occasion that would honour the sanctity of Indian rituals while embracing a refined international aesthetic, the wedding unfolded as an elegant convergence of tradition, design, couture, and emotion. Despite its scale, the experience remained deeply personal, its intimacy preserved through thoughtful, bespoke design and meticulously curated guest journeys that flowed seamlessly across the private villas, the North Pool, Al Masarra, and the iconic Nesma Courtyard.

Haldi Ceremony

The festivities opened with an auspicious Haldi ceremony hosted within the privacy of the resort’s Royal Villa, where sun-drenched spaces were enveloped in abundant bougainvillea blooms cascading in blush-pink hues. Multi-hued layers of pink florals framed the setting with a gentle, romantic warmth, transforming the Royal Villa into a serene sanctuary that felt both regal and deeply personal. The décor was thoughtfully designed to mirror the property’s natural pink florals, blending seamlessly with its architecture rather than overpowering it. Designed as a moment of quiet celebration, the setting enveloped the couple in warmth, colour, and familial intimacy. Surrounded by only their closest family, traditional rituals unfolded at an unhurried pace, allowing emotion and culture to take precedence over scale. The air was alive with upbeat percussion by DJ Hriday and a graceful floral shower for the couple marked a joyful crescendo, offering a stunning visual and emotional beginning to the celebrations.

Mehendi Lunch

The Mehendi lunch unfolded by the North Pool as an elegant celebration inspired by the sea. Styled in 50 Shades of Blue” from soft aquas to deep marine hues, the décor mirrored the stunning ocean vista, embracing a refined nautical aesthetic that felt fluid, fresh, and impeccably composed. Every visual detail including a larger than life white oyster shell that served as a photo backdrop, strings of pearls, corals, ship motifs, and other nautical elements were thoughtfully layered, allowing the coastal surroundings to frame the experience with effortless sophistication. An interactive charm station introduced a personalised touch, inviting the lady guests to craft their own bag charms using sea-inspired elements such as sea horses, starfish, pearls, shells, glass beads, alphabets and other trinkets into meaningful keepsakes. The couple’s Mehendi entry was announced by rhythmic Dhols, their beats ushering in a moment of joyful arrival, an energised expression of tradition set in elegant contrast to the celebration’s refined coastal setting. The atmosphere was further elevated by Dubai-based percussionist Walter, whose rhythmic water drumming added a distinctive coastal cadence, seamlessly complemented by DJ Konark and Walter’s curated daytime sets of Water Drums and Roaming Snare Drums that sustained a vibrant energy. Curated culinary experiences saw a bespoke Sangria Bar programme featuring Sangria, Aperol Spritz and innovative beverages, subtly reinforcing the nautical narrative through flavour and presentation. Together, design, sound, and hospitality converged to create a Mehendi celebration that was immersive, graceful and quietly spectacular, striking the perfect balance between grandeur and relaxed luxury.

Fashion & Style

Fashion played a defining role in shaping the wedding’s stunning visual narrative. Raina Singh’s bridal journey unfolded through distinct couture moments, beginning with Mrunalini Rao for the Haldi, transitioning into vibrant elegance by Arpita Mehta for the Mehendi, followed by statement ensembles by Tarun Tahiliani and Sabyasachi for the Sangeet, and culminating in a refined Sufi Night look by Nakul Sen. Ankush Sehgal complemented this sartorial narrative with ensembles by Divyam Mehta, Rohit Bal, and Rohit & Rahul, each look echoing the refined, contemporary elegance of the celebration.

The gastronomy across three days was meticulously curated to mirror each celebration’s theme, with an expansive culinary spread where over 20 Live Stations flowed seamlessly into an array of bespoke dining experiences. A discerning global palate was indulged with Mediterranean and Continental fare, elevated Indian street food, nuanced Asian flavours, and a diverse selection of highlight dishes from around the world coupled with curated bars featuring bespoke cocktails, premium spirits, and artisanal mixers.
